For the archives: Very important and complete documentation of private
(and public) properties throughout the whole country from the18th cent.
until the present day
For public users: Inestimable value for the reconstruction and
developments of family properties
For scholars: Records serve multiple questions – agrarian and urban
history of settlements; economic and social structure of individual villages
towns, cities; historical geography; long-term research e.g. on the
transition from early modern society to the age of industrialisation
Importance of the Holdings

- Digitisation and handwritten text recognition
- Index of owners, parcels (and information related to the parcels)
- Processing and linking of data from different cadastral registers
(database)
- Visualisation of data in the corresponding maps
What Archivists Would Like Computer Scientists Do
